How they compare
Romania currently reports 3,200 number against 2,972 number in Syrian Arab Republic, a difference of 228 number.
That makes Romania's figure about 1.1 times Syrian Arab Republic's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 15 shared years of data; in 1993 it was Romania ahead.
Romania ranks 63rd and Syrian Arab Republic ranks 64th of 183 countries.
Syrian Arab Republic has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Romania | Syrian Arab Republic |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 7,140 number | 10,502 number | 3,362 number | Syrian Arab Republic |
| 2000s | 3,075 number | 7,913 number | 4,839 number | Syrian Arab Republic |
| 2010s | 2,608 number | 5,622 number | 3,014 number | Syrian Arab Republic |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
